| CVE | Summary | Source | Max CVSS | EPSS % | Published | Updated |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| CVE-2021-31650 | A SQL injection vulnerability in Sourcecodester Online Grading System 1.0 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ands via the uname parameter. | [email protected] | 9.8 | 0.49% | 2022-12-16 | 2025-04-21 |
| CVE-2019-18344 | Sourcecodester Online Grading System 1.0 is vulnerable to unauthenticated SQL injection and can allow remote att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ands via the student, instructor, department, room, class, or user page (id or classid parameter). | [email protected] | 9.8 | 0.62% | 2019-10-23 | 2024-11-21 |
| CVE-2019-18280 | Sourcecodester Online Grading System 1.0 is affected by a Cross Site Request Forgery vulnerability due to a lack of CSRF protection. This could lead to an attacker tricking the administrator into executing arbitrary code via a crafted HTML page, as demonstrated by a Create User action at the admin/modules/user/controller.php?action=add URI. | [email protected] | 8.8 | 0.18% | 2019-10-23 | 2024-11-21 |
